    Description: 
Semantic versioning fails because we introduce a new error message.  I'm not 
sure that qualifies, but the rules say that violates the 
increment-the-3rd-digit policy.

Also, we'll be releasing a bug fix for binary delta cas serialization which 
produces an incompatible serialized form not readable by old uima versions.  
This will most likely be completely hidden by an update to uima-as, but is 
another reason to bump the middle number.  See UIMA-4743

Now, there is also a new utils class CasIOUtils with public methods/interfaces, 
which also violates the enforcer rule. With the help of this class, new 
functionality is introduced in the CAS Editor: enough reasons to make a minor 
release instead of a bugfix one.
